Why Termites Are Such a Threat

Unlike other pests, termites feed on cellulose, which is found in timber, paper, and even some fabrics. This makes homes a prime target, especially in climates where warmth and humidity create ideal conditions for colonies to thrive.


There are a few key reasons termites pose such a significant risk:


  • Termites can remain undetected for months or years, tunnelling behind walls, under floors, and within roof timbers.
  • They consume wood from the inside out, which means a structure may look fine on the surface but be severely weakened internally.
  • Colonies proliferate, with thousands of termites working together to feed around the clock.

Signs of Termite Activity That Homeowners Often Miss


Because termites prefer dark, concealed spaces, the signs of their activity are often subtle. Homeowners may overlook or misinterpret early warning signals until significant damage has occurred. Some of the most common indicators include:


  • Hollow-sounding timber when tapped, suggesting termites have eaten through the inside.
  • Mud tubes along walls or foundations, which termites use to travel safely from their colony to their food source.
  • Discarded wings near windows or doors, left behind by swarmers when establishing new colonies.
  • Uneven or bubbling paint, which may look like water damage, but could be termite activity underneath.

Why Professional Inspections Are Essential


While it’s possible to spot a few warning signs, termite infestations are often hidden deep within a structure. Professional inspectors use tools, training, and experience that the average homeowner does not have.


The benefits of arranging a termite inspection near you include:


  • Inspectors know where to look, focusing on areas most vulnerable to termite activity, such as foundations, crawl spaces, and roof voids.
  • They use specialised equipment to detect movement, moisture, and activity behind walls and under floors.
  • A professional inspection comes with a clear report outlining concerns and recommending appropriate treatments.

Seasonal & Local Termite Risks


In regions with warm, humid conditions, termite activity remains a risk all year round. While colonies never truly rest, their activity often peaks during certain times of the year—particularly after rainfall. Moist soil and higher humidity provide the perfect environment for termites to expand their colonies, making homes even more vulnerable.


For homeowners seeking termite treatment in Darwin, the local climate makes regular inspections especially critical. Darwin’s combination of heat and humidity creates conditions where termites can thrive continuously, with little seasonal slowdown. This is why annual inspections are considered the minimum safeguard, while bi-annual inspections are often recommended for added protection.

Pairing Inspections with Effective Treatment


While inspections are the first line of defence, treatment is equally essential when termite activity is found. Modern treatments are designed to be both practical and long-lasting, creating a protective barrier around your home.


When you arrange a termite treatment near you, professionals will tailor the approach to your property’s needs. This may include baiting systems, chemical soil treatments, or targeted applications designed to eliminate the colony and prevent reinfestation.
